The Jurisdiction may authorize participation in the Program for one (1) year or for <br />multiple consecutive calendar years, with mutual agreement from the County. A multi-year <br />authorization shall specify the total annual contribution amount for each year covered and <br />shall remain subject to annual adjustment of the County’s administrative cost percentage. <br />The Jurisdiction may revise or rescind its authorization for any future year by providing <br />written notice to the County no later than November 1 preceding the year for which the <br />change is requested. <br />D. The Jurisdiction shall be responsible for completing and submitting its EAR to <br />CalRecycle, reporting the information provided by the County. <br />E. The Jurisdiction shall pay any additional invoices it has approved in writing, within <br />forty-five (45) days of receipt, for supplemental contributions to the Program or for <br />additional projects and agreements undertaken by the County on the Jurisdiction’s behalf. <br />3. Consideration <br />This MOU enables the continuation of the collaborative Program, jointly developed by the <br />Jurisdiction, County, and RCD since 2021. By participating in this MOU, the Jurisdiction avoids <br />the administrative and financial burden of creating and managing a separate contract or Program <br />and allocating staff time, allowing the County on behalf of all the cities in San Mateo County to <br />leverage economies of scale to reduce countywide SB 1383 procurement compliance costs. <br />In return, the Jurisdiction contributes funding to the Program and receives procurement credit in <br />proportion to its contribution. This Program advances shared countywide goals by strengthening <br />local food system resiliency, improving soil health, reducing climate impacts, and supporting long- <br />term economic and environmental benefits across San Mateo County. <br />4.
